VELCO is Vermont’s statewide electric transmission provider whose sights are set on creating a sustainable Vermont through our people, assets, relationships and operating model. Formed in 1956 when local Vermont utilities established the nation’s first “transmission only” company to access clean hydro power from New York, VELCO remains unique in two important ways: 1. Our ownership comprises the state’s 17 distribution utilities and a public benefits corporation; and, 2. our for-profit status is structured to return cooperative-like value to our owners, their customers, and every Vermonter. VELCO’s system now includes: 740 miles of transmission lines; 55 substations, switching stations and terminal facilities; 13,000 acres of rights-of-way; a statewide emergency service radio system; and, a 1,600-mile fiber optic network that monitors and controls the electric system and helps to deliver broadband services to Vermonters. Headquartered in Rutland, Vermont, VELCO employees strive to give Vermont’s utilities and their customers a reliable high-voltage grid, a strong unified voice on regional energy issues, and continued access to safe, reliable, cost-effective electricity.

BARTON International delivers the highest performance industrial garnet and mineral abrasives in the world. We offer blasting and waterjet abrasives that solve any challenge in waterjet cutting, surface preparation, grinding and polishing. Specifically developed for waterjet cutting, BARTON waterjet abrasives are as effective on thick steel or titanium as they are on composites, laminates, printed circuit boards, fiber-optic cables and other fragile materials. Our Mil-Spec and CARB-approved garnet blasting abrasives come in a variety of grades that perform across a range of applications, from pack rust on bridges and ship hulls to mill scale on new steel and projects with less-demanding profile requirements. Operators enjoy maximum productivity and low dusting for superior safety. Our four-tier abrasive product line offers different levels of value and performance: ADIRONDACK® Mined and milled in the USA, our world-renowned ADIRONDACK garnet is the most refined hard rock garnet abrasive in the world. Its ever-sharp crystalline structure makes it the fastest, cleanest, most precise blasting and waterjet cutting abrasive available. ALLTEK™ This globally sourced alluvial garnet abrasive combines superior blasting and waterjet cutting performance with economy. It’s perfect for jobs that don’t require the ultra-high performance of our ADIRONDACK garnet. FUSION® The newest product in our line of abrasives, FUSION is a custom blend of ALLTEK alluvial garnet and ECOTEK staurolite for a general-purpose abrasive that balances cutting consistency with cost. ECOTEK® STL This domestically produced waterjet cutting abrasive provides solid cutting performance for customers focused on material costs. AGTServices provides full service generator maintenance for all turbine-generators. Services include routine maintenance inspections and repairs or upgrades, to full scale stator or field rewinds. AGTServices takes pride in our ability to develop creative solutions to help get your generator back into operation in the fastest time possible. With most of our HQ engineering and field service personnel "growing up"​ with the OEM's, there isn't a generator we cannot handle. From 5MW to 1500MW, AGTServices can perform any of the services or repairs that the "big boys"​ can, but with more speed, flexibility and creativity!

Burr and Burton Academy is an independent, coeducational New England secondary school that serves as the school of choice for students from Manchester and several surrounding communities. Established in 1829, Burr and Burton is committed to educating students of diverse backgrounds and talents in a warm and caring environment that encourages excellence, respect for one another and community service. The school strives to widen its cultural breadth by attracting students from various ethnic, racial, socioeconomic and geographic backgrounds. Burr and Burton offers a broad and challenging curriculum that seeks a balance between science and the liberal arts. Faculty members strive to instill in their students a love of lifelong learning through their examples and their guidance. The school actively promotes good citizenship, personal responsibility, and service to the wider community.

As a leading MGA in the collateral protection market, Lee & Mason provides clients blanket, lender-placed, and tracking solutions for residential, commercial, and consumer loan portfolios. Unlike many of our competitors, Lee & Mason operates as a full-service program administrator that is deeply committed to data security and evolving systems and operational technology. We handle the entire process from quoting to claims payment and represent over a half-dozen A.M. Best 'A' rated insurance carriers including our status as Coverholder for Lloyd's. To date we represent nearly 2,000 clients nationwide. Understanding that every lender is unique, we take the time to customize insurance solutions specific to their portfolio and needs.
